Hobarts Close is a residential street with 12 addresses.
It ranks as the 150th largest and 487th most expensive of the 573 streets in the GL3 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 12 properties: 12 houses.
Sale prices range from £395,567 for 4 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,151 ft2) to £486,954 for 4 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,722 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,766 pcm for 4 bed houses to £2,053 pcm for 4 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 5.1% and 5.4%.
The average value per square foot is £324.
The last sale on Hobarts Close sold for £471,545 on 29th July 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 2.0%.
The current average value in the street is £433,618.
The Hobarts Close Sales Market has increased by 41.2%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 29th July 2024 for £471,545 and since then the market in the area has increased by 2.0%. The street has had a total of 13 sales since 1995.
Hobarts Close, Innsworth, Gloucester, GL3 has seen 1 sale in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Hobarts Close, Innsworth, Gloucester, GL3 is the 150th largest and the 487th most expensive street in the GL3 area.
There is 1 postcode on Hobarts Close, Innsworth, Gloucester, GL3.
The closest station to Hobarts Close, Innsworth, Gloucester, GL3 is Gloucester station which is 3.3 kilometres away.
